Strategy

A two-dart checkout: T17, D8. Hit the treble first to set up the double. If your T17 lands in S17, you'll need 67 with 2 darts remaining. A miss sideways into the 2 or 3 segments changes the equation significantly. You'll encounter 67 frequently in competitive 501 and 301 play.

Alternative Routes

The standard route T17 → D8 is the most commonly used combination for 67.

Pro Tip

D8 is part of the D16 halving chain and a well-practiced double for most players. Missing into S8 leaves D4, keeping you in the halving sequence. It's located on the left side of the board.
